valsi soi'au
type experimental cmavo
creator krtisfranks
time entered Tue Oct 18 07:14:19 2016

Examples
   
English
Definition #68957 - Preferred [edit]
   
selma'o PA
definition almost none/almost no/almost nowhere (technical sense): the subset of satisfactory such things is null but non-empty.
notes This word does not potentially include "no"; there exists at least one element of the universal set which is satisfactory; for inclusion of either option, use "su'esoi'au"; this extra requirement is analogous to "ci" not including "re" or "su'e ci" and is directly similar to the distinction between "soi'au" and "su'osoi'ai". This word can be used as a quantifier. See also: "soi'ai", "pisoi'au".
